The Baddi Industrial Area in Himachal Pradesh has emerged as a key manufacturing hub in North India, particularly renowned for its concentration of pharmaceutical, f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G), and engineering industries. According to Mordor Intelligence, India’s pharmaceutical market is projected to grow at a CAGR of over 12.5% from 2023 to 2028, with Baddi contributing significantly to this expansion—hosting more than 400 manufacturing units, including over 200 pharmaceutical companies. This industrial boom, supported by tax incentives and strategic location near major highways, has fueled strong demand for skilled professionals across technical, operational, and managerial roles. As Grand View Research notes, the growing domestic and export demand for Indian-made goods is accelerating job creation in manufacturing clusters like Baddi. In this dynamic landscape, nine key roles—including Production Supervisors, Quality Assurance Managers, and Maintenance Engineers—are seeing heightened recruitment, reflecting both sectoral growth and the region’s expanding industrial footprint.

2026 Market Trends for Jobs in Baddi Industrial Area

Baddi, located in Himachal Pradesh, stands as one of India’s largest industrial clusters, particularly renowned for its dominance in pharmaceuticals, f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G), and engineering. As we approach 2026, the job market in Baddi is poised for transformation driven by national policy shifts, technological advancements, and evolving industry demands. Here’s a detailed analysis of the key trends expected to shape employment opportunities in the region.

H2: Increasing Demand for Skilled Technical and Green-Certified Workforce

By 2026, Baddi’s industrial employers are expected to prioritize hiring professionals with specialized technical skills, particularly in automation, process optimization, and sustainable manufacturing practices. The Indian government’s Production-Linked Incentive (PLI) scheme and a national push toward “Make in India” and “Atmanirbhar Bharat” will continue to attract investments into pharmaceuticals and electronics manufacturing in Baddi. This will increase demand for:

  • Automation and Robotics Technicians: With rising adoption of Industry 4.0 technologies, companies will seek technicians capable of maintaining and programming automated production lines.
  • Green Manufacturing Specialists: As environmental regulations tighten and 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) compliance becomes critical, roles in waste management, energy efficiency, and carbon footprint reduction will grow. Workers with certifications in green manufacturing or environmental safety will be highly sought after.
  • Skilled Maintenance Engineers: With aging infrastructure and newer high-tech machinery, there will be a sustained need for engineers trained in predictive maintenance and PLC (Programmable Logic Controller) systems.

Additionally, the Himachal Pradesh government’s focus on cleaner industrial practices is likely to mandate stricter pollution control standards, further boosting demand for environmental compliance officers and sustainability auditors in industrial units.

In conclusion, the 2026 job landscape in Baddi will favor candidates with up-to-date technical certifications and a strong understanding of sustainable industrial practices. Upskilling through vocational training programs aligned with industry 4.0 and green manufacturing will be crucial for job seekers aiming to capitalize on emerging opportunities.

Logistics & Compliance Guide for Jobs in Baddi Industrial Area

Baddi, located in Himachal Pradesh, is one of North India’s largest industrial hubs, hosting hundreds of pharmaceutical, manufacturing, and FMCG companies. For job seekers and professionals working in or moving to Baddi, understanding the logistics and compliance aspects is crucial for smooth operations and legal adherence. This guide outlines key considerations related to transportation, legal requirements, and workplace compliance relevant to employment in the Baddi Industrial Area.

Transportation and Commute Logistics

Efficient transportation is essential due to Baddi’s semi-urban location and dispersed industrial zones.

  • Public Transport Options: Baddi is connected via Himachal Road Transport Corporation (HRTC) and private buses from nearby cities like Chandigarh, Solan, and Shimla. Regular shuttle services operate between Chandigarh and Baddi, making daily commuting feasible.
  • Private Transport: Many employees and companies rely on private vehicles or cabs. Two-wheelers and four-wheelers are common; ensure vehicles are registered under the Himachal Pradesh RTO.
  • Last-Mile Connectivity: Factories are often located on the outskirts. Consider shared transport or company-provided shuttles for easier access.
  • Parking Facilities: Verify parking availability at your workplace or residence. Industrial units usually provide employee parking, but space can be limited.

Residential and Accommodation Logistics

Finding suitable housing is vital for long-term employment.

  • Nearby Residential Areas: Popular localities include Baddi town, Barotiwala, Nalagarh, and Solan. Rentals vary based on proximity and amenities.
  • Company-Provided Housing: Some large employers offer staff quarters or tie-ups with local accommodations.
  • Utilities and Internet: Ensure your residence has reliable electricity, water, and high-speed internet—important for remote work or communication.

Legal and Employment Compliance

Adhering to regional and national labor laws is mandatory for both employees and employers.

  • Work Permits and Residency: No special work permit is required for Indian citizens. However, updating your address in official documents (Aadhaar, PAN) is recommended.
  • Employment Contracts: Ensure your job offer includes a formal contract detailing salary, work hours, leave policy, and termination clauses as per the Industrial Employment (Standing Orders) Act, 1946.
  • PF and ESI Registration: Employers with more than 20 employees must register under EPFO (Employees’ Provident Fund) and ESIC (Employees’ State Insurance Corporation). Confirm your enrollment.
  • Shop and Establishment Act: All industrial units must register under the Himachal Pradesh Shops and Establishments Act, regulating working hours, leave, and employee rights.

Industry-Specific Regulatory Compliance

Baddi hosts many pharma and manufacturing units, subject to strict regulations.

  • Pharmaceutical Sector: Companies must comply with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), WHO standards, and licenses from the Drugs Controller General of India (DCGI). Employees in quality, production, or R&D must be trained in compliance protocols.
  • Environmental Norms: Industries must follow Himachal Pradesh Pollution Control Board (HPPCB) guidelines for waste disposal, emissions, and effluent treatment. Workers should be aware of safety and environmental procedures.
  • Factory Act Compliance: The Factories Act, 1948 mandates safety measures, welfare facilities, and working hour limits. Workers must receive training on hazardous processes if applicable.

Safety and Workplace Standards

Employee safety is a top priority in industrial settings.

  •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Use mandated PPE like helmets, gloves, masks, and safety shoes, especially in production or lab environments.
  • Emergency Protocols: Familiarize yourself with fire exits, assembly points, and emergency contact numbers. Participate in regular drills.
  • Health Checks: Some roles require periodic medical examinations under the Factories Act.

Tax and Financial Compliance

Understanding tax obligations ensures financial discipline.

  • Income Tax: Salaries are subject to TDS (Tax Deducted at Source). File ITR annually and keep Form 16 for records.
  • Himachal Pradesh Local Taxes: No VAT or local body tax on employment, but ensure professional tax compliance if applicable (though currently not levied in HP).
  • Banking: Open a local bank account for convenient salary crediting and transactions.

Conclusion

Working in Baddi’s industrial area offers strong career opportunities, especially in pharma and manufacturing. However, success depends on navigating logistical challenges and adhering to compliance norms. Whether you’re an employee or a new hire, prioritize understanding transportation, housing, legal rights, and safety standards. Staying compliant not only ensures job stability but also contributes to a safe and productive work environment in one of India’s fastest-growing industrial zones.

Conclusion for Sourcing Jobs in Baddi Industrial Area:

The Baddi Industrial Area, located in Himachal Pradesh, stands out as one of North India’s most prominent industrial hubs, particularly known for its robust presence in pharmaceuticals, f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G), engineering, and electronics manufacturing. This concentration of diverse industries creates ample employment opportunities across skill levels, making it a favorable destination for job seekers and recruitment professionals alike.

Sourcing jobs in Baddi offers several advantages, including a growing demand for both blue-collar and white-collar workforce, relatively lower operational costs for businesses, and consistent industrial growth supported by state government incentives. Additionally, the region’s strategic location near major transportation routes enhances its connectivity and logistical efficiency, further attracting investments and job-generating enterprises.

However, job sourcing in Baddi also presents challenges such as information asymmetry, skill gaps in the local workforce, and limited digital penetration in recruitment processes. To overcome these, active engagement with local training institutes, collaboration with staffing agencies, and leveraging digital platforms can significantly improve talent acquisition outcomes.

In conclusion, Baddi Industrial Area remains a promising region for sourcing jobs, especially in manufacturing and allied sectors. With structured recruitment strategies, emphasis on skill development, and improved access to job networks, both employers and candidates can benefit from the area’s expanding industrial landscape. As the region continues to evolve, it holds strong potential to become a sustainable employment hub in northern India.
